What do you think is the future of the Toronto Real Estate Market?
Even before COVID-19, we saw a shortage of housing in Toronto and now we see the markets have dropped significantly. As listings are also on the downward trend, it will keep the prices relatively stable. Recovery depends on one thing: Employment. If unemployment is high, chances are that the housing market will take a hit, but not a significant one — maybe 5-8% drop. And rentals vacancies will be at an all-time low.

As soon as people get back to work, the process and the market will take off. 2020 be a lackluster year until people have confidence that they have job security. 2021 we should see new record highs, but this depends on how quickly we find the vaccine and how we prepare for a 2nd wave.

It’s hard to predict how long COVID-19 will continue to be a threat, along with its impacts on individuals, businesses, and the market, but this is our take on the future of the #TorontoMortgageMarket right now.

Like all economic cycles, they recover over time. Our world may look very different in the coming months or years but humans adapt and persevere. #BePrepared and plan.
